The Role of Social Media in Gambling Culture
Social media has revolutionized the way people interact with gambling. Plat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and Twitter serve as digital arenas where users share experiences, strategies, and success stories about gambling. This sharing not only normalizes gambling behaviors but can also glamorize them, making it appear as a casual part of everyday life. Users often showcase their winnings, which can influence peers to engage in similar activities, further embedding gambling into social culture. The integration of gambling advertisements within social media feeds further accelerates this trend. Targeted ads, tailored to user preferences and behaviors, lead to higher engagement rates. For instance, a user who interacts with gambling-related content is more likely to see ads for online casinos or sports betting. This creates an environment where gambling becomes increasingly accessible and appealing, often without users even realizing their susceptibility to such influences.
Moreover, the phenomenon of “gamification” in social media adds an additional layer of appeal. Elements like rewards, points, and levels entice users to engage with gambling content more actively. This not only enhances user experience but also encourages behavior that could lead to actual gambling. The influence of social media on gambling culture is profound and multifaceted, illustrating a shift in how people perceive and participate in gambling activities.
The Psychological Impact of Social Media on Gambling Behavior
The psychological effects of social media on gambling behavior can be significant. The instant gratification provided by likes, shares, and comments can create a feedback loop that encourages more gambling. When users post about their gambling experiences and receive positive reinforcement from their peers, it can affirm their behaviors, making them more likely to gamble again. This dynamic can be particularly dangerous for vulnerable individuals who may struggle with impulse control.
Moreover, social media can create a false sense of community among gamblers. Users often participate in discussions and form groups around their shared interest in gambling, fostering a sense of belonging. While this can provide social support, it may also reinforce unhealthy behaviors as members encourage each other to gamble more. The pressure to share wins and experiences can lead to excessive gambling to maintain one’s online persona, pushing individuals further into the gambling cycle.
The blend of social validation and competitive spirit nurtured by social media contributes to increased gambling frequency and intensity. This can escalate into problematic behavior, as individuals may prioritize gambling over other activities or responsibilities, all while seeking the validation of their online peers. Understanding these psychological impacts is crucial in addressing and mitigating the risks associated with gambling influenced by social media.
The Influence of Celebrity Endorsements and Influencers
Celebrity endorsements and influencers play a pivotal role in shaping gambling behavior on social media. Famous personalities often promote gambling platforms, showcasing their glamorous lifestyles that may include gambling as a central element. This strategy effectively reaches millions of followers, many of whom may feel inspired or pressured to emulate their idols. As a result, gambling becomes intertwined with notions of success and aspiration.
Influencers, in particular, have emerged as powerful figures in the gambling space. Their authentic connections with followers can significantly impact gambling attitudes and behaviors. When influencers discuss their experiences or promote specific casinos, they lend credibility to the activity, making it more appealing. Followers are more likely to trust these recommendations compared to traditional advertisements, which often lack the same personal touch.
This phenomenon raises ethical concerns, especially regarding responsible gambling. When celebrities and influencers promote gambling without adequately addressing its risks, they can inadvertently encourage reckless behavior among their audiences. The allure of celebrity culture combined with gambling can lead to an oversaturation of gambling content on social media, making it essential to scrutinize these endorsements critically. This dynamic highlights the need for regulatory measures to protect audiences from potential exploitation.
Trends in Online Gambling Driven by Social Media
Social media trends significantly shape the evolution of online gambling platforms. Features like live streaming have become increasingly popular, allowing users to engage in real-time betting while interacting with friends or influencers. This immersive experience combines the thrill of gambling with the social aspects of digital interaction, making it more enticing for users. The rise of mobile gaming, facilitated by social media, further amplifies this trend, allowing gambling to take place anytime and anywhere.
Additionally, the introduction of social features in online gambling platforms, such as chat rooms and leaderboards, enhances user engagement. Players can compete against friends or share their achievements online, fostering a sense of community that can drive more frequent participation. This social aspect transforms gambling into a more communal activity, which may appeal to younger demographics accustomed to connecting through social media.
As technology continues to evolve, the integration of virtual and augmented reality into gambling experiences can also be expected. Imagine a scenario where users can interact in a virtual casino environment with their friends, combining the allure of gaming with social interaction. These trends, largely driven by social media dynamics, are shaping the future of gambling, making it more engaging but also necessitating a focus on responsible gaming practices.
